MARINARA PREMIUM SAUCE
Summary
This marinara sauce features a clean ingredient list with beneficial components such as tomatoes, onions, and avocado oil, which provide vitamins, antioxidants, and healthy fats. The use of avocado oil instead of seed oils is a positive aspect, and the absence of artificial additives or preservatives enhances its nutritional profile. Despite being processed, the sauce maintains a high score due to its high-quality ingredients and minimal processing.

Key ingredients 7
TomatoesVery Good
Tomatoes are a rich source of v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ants, particularly lycopene. They are minimally processed in this sauce, retaining most of their nutritional benefits. Lycopene is linked to reduced risk of heart disease and certain cancers.
Benefits
Rich in vitamins C and K, folate, and potassium. Lycopene provides antioxidant properties that may protect against chronic diseases.
OnionsGood
Onions are a good source of v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ants, including quercetin. They are used in their natural form, contributing to the sauce's flavor and nutritional profile. Quercetin has anti-inflammatory and immune-boosting properties.
Benefits
Provides antioxidants that may reduce inflammation and support immune function.
Avocado oilVery Good
Avocado oil is a high-quality source of monounsaturated fats, similar to olive oil. It is cold-pressed, preserving its beneficial compounds and nutrients. These fats support heart health and have anti-inflammatory effects.
Benefits
Rich in monounsaturated fats that support heart health and provide anti-inflammatory properties.
SaltNeutral
Salt is used as a seasoning and preservative in foods. It is a refined form of sodium chloride without additional trace minerals. While necessary for bodily functions, excessive intake can lead to health issues.
Risks
High sodium intake can contribute to hypertension and cardiovascular diseases.
Benefits
Essential for maintaining fluid balance and nerve function.
GarlicVery Good
Garlic is known for its potent antioxidant and anti-inflammatory properties. It is used in its natural form, enhancing both flavor and health benefits. Allicin, a compound in garlic, is linked to improved heart health and immune function.
Benefits
May support cardiovascular health and boost the immune system.
BasilGood
Basil is a herb rich in antioxidants and essential oils. It is used fresh or dried, contributing to the sauce's flavor and nutritional value. Basil's antioxidants may help reduce oxidative stress.
Benefits
Contains antioxidants that may support overall health and reduce inflammation.
SpicesGood
Spices add flavor and potential health benefits to the sauce. They are typically used in small amounts and can include a variety of beneficial compounds. Many spices have antioxidant and anti-inflammatory properties.
Benefits
May provide antioxidants and enhance the flavor profile of the sauce.
